NVR, Inc. (NYSE:NVR) Shares Purchased by PYA Waltman Capital LLC

PYA Waltman Capital LLC grew its stake in NVR, Inc. (NYSE:NVR - Free Report) by 20.2%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The firm owned 523 shares of the construction company's stock after buying an additional 88 shares during the quarter. NVR accounts for approximately 1.4% of PYA Waltman Capital LLC's portfolio, making the stock its 19th biggest position. PYA Waltman Capital LLC's holdings in NVR were worth $4,278,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

A number of other institutional investors and hedge funds have also made changes to their positions in the stock. Blue Trust Inc. purchased a new position in NVR in the third quarter worth approximately $39,000. Rakuten Securities Inc. purchased a new stake in shares of NVR during the 3rd quarter worth $39,000. Private Trust Co. NA grew its stake in shares of NVR by 66.7% during the third quarter. Private Trust Co. NA now owns 5 shares of the construction company's stock worth $49,000 after purchasing an additional 2 shares in the last quarter. Wilmington Savings Fund Society FSB purchased a new position in NVR in the third quarter valued at $49,000. Finally, Quantbot Technologies LP purchased a new position in NVR in the third quarter valued at $59,000. 83.67% of the stock is owned by institutional investors and hedge funds.

Insider Transactions at NVR

In other news, Director Thomas D. Eckert sold 143 shares of the business's stock in a transaction on Monday, February 10th. The shares were sold at an average price of $7,515.60, for a total transaction of $1,074,730.80. Following the completion of the sale, the director now directly owns 1,050 shares of the company's stock, valued at $7,891,380. The trade was a 11.99 % dec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at this link. Insiders own 7.00% of the company's stock.

NVR Price Performance

NVR stock traded up $265.58 during trading hours on Tuesday, hitting $7,327.60. The stock had a trading volume of 25,914 shares, compared to its average volume of 27,433. The stock has a market capitalization of $21.91 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 14.44, a PEG ratio of 2.39 and a beta of 1.20. NVR, Inc. has a 1-year low of $7,015.00 and a 1-year high of $9,964.77. The stock's fifty day moving average is $7,930.80 and its two-hundred day moving average is $8,768.00.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.22, a current ratio of 6.18 and a quick ratio of 3.69.

NVR (NYSE:NVR -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 4th. The construction company reported $139.93 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$132.63 by $7.30. NVR had a return on equity of 39.67% and a net margin of 16.34%. As a group, analysts predict that NVR, Inc. will post 505.2 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

NVR announced that its board has initiated a share buyback program on Wednesday, December 11th that allows the company to buyback $750.00 million in shares. This buyback authorization allows the construction company to buy up to 2.8% of its shares through open market purchases. Shares buyback programs are often an indication that the company's board believes its shares are undervalued.

Wall Street Analysts Forecast Growth

NVR has been the subject of several recent analyst reports. StockNews.com cut NVR from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Thursday, November 7th. UBS Group raised their price target on NVR from $8,750.00 to $8,900.00 and gave the stock a "neutral" rating in a report on Wednesday, January 29th. Seaport Res Ptn cut NVR from a "strong-bu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Sunday, November 10th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. dropped their target price on NVR from $9,245.00 to $8,570.00 and set a "neutral" rating on the stock in a research report on Wednesday, January 29th. Four investment anal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ating and one has assigned a buy r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, NVR has an average rating of "Hold" and a consensus price target of $9,356.67.

NVR Company Profile

NVR, Inc operates as a homebuilder in the United States. The company operates through, Homebuilding and Mortgage Banking segments. It engages in the construction and sale of single-family detached homes, townhomes, and condominium buildings under the Ryan Homes, NVHomes, and Heartland Homes names. The company markets its Ryan Homes products to first-time and first-time move-up buyers; and NVHomes and Heartland Homes products to move-up and luxury buyers.
